Understanding Premium Wedding Cinematography Packages in Goa
Pricing for premium wedding cinematography packages in Goa is shaped by several layers of craft and logistics. At the entry tier (₹1.5 lakh–₹3 lakh), couples typically receive a two-photographer setup with one videographer, basic drone footage, same-day edited highlights, and a full-resolution photo gallery delivered within 30–45 days. Mid-tier packages (₹3 lakh–₹6 lakh) include a lead photographer with two or three associates, a dedicated cinematography director, full multi-day event coverage, a 12–15 minute cinematic wedding film, and a pre-wedding shoot at a chosen Goa location. The premium tier (₹6 lakh–₹10 lakh and above) adds second-camera cinematographers, colour-graded feature films running 25–40 minutes, fine-art album printing, and international-standard post-production with licensed background scores. Travel and accommodation for the photography team is almost always billed separately and can add ₹50,000–₹1.5 lakh depending on team size and event duration. Always ask whether the quoted package includes assistant photographers, external hard-drive backups, and insurance coverage for equipment. A well-structured Luxury Destination Wedding Photography & Video Experience contract will also specify delivery timelines, copyright ownership, and revision rounds for the edited film. Couples with a wedding planning budget in Goa should allocate at minimum 10–12% of their total spend to photography and video, because these deliverables outlast every other vendor's contribution. Understanding what is included at each pricing tier prevents last-minute surprises and ensures the final product matches your vision.
How Do Cinematic Wedding Film Production and Photography Work Together?
The most immersive Luxury Destination Wedding Photography & Video Experiences treat photography and videography not as parallel tracks but as one unified storytelling effort. The lead cinematographer and lead photographer communicate continuously — when the photographer signals that bride's entry light is perfect, the cinema team rolls simultaneously, ensuring neither medium compromises the other. Cinematic wedding film production in Goa typically involves Sony or RED cinema cameras, Ronin stabilisers for smooth movement across sandy or uneven terrain, and DJI drones licensed under DGCA regulations. The resulting film is not a simple event recording; it is a colour-graded short film with a narrative arc — opening with the arrivals and location beauty shots of Goa beach wedding venues, building through rituals, and resolving with an emotional reception montage. High-end bridal portrait sessions are a separate creative element within this ecosystem: a 60–90 minute session where the couple is styled and directed on location — perhaps amid the terracotta walls of Old Goa's Latin Quarter or on a wooden dhow at dusk on the Mandovi River — producing magazine-quality images distinct from the documentary flow. Pre-wedding shoot locations in Goa like Chapora Fort, Dudhsagar Falls, Cabo de Rama, and the Fontainhas heritage district are perennial favourites because of their contrast with Bollywood-style studio looks. Synchronising all these creative streams requires a single point of contact — usually a creative director — who ensures consistent visual style across thousands of photographs and hours of footage.
Choosing Between Destination Wedding Photo and Video Coverage Styles
Not all Luxury Destination Wedding Photography & Video Experiences look the same, and understanding stylistic differences is crucial before you sign a contract. The three dominant styles in contemporary Indian destination wedding photography are documentary (candid-led), editorial (fashion-forward), and traditional (posed, ritual-focused). Documentary teams let moments unfold and capture raw emotion — the grandmother wiping a tear, the groomsmen's nervous laughter — with minimal intervention. Editorial teams treat every shot like a magazine spread, directing posture, curating backgrounds, and delivering images that look like a Vogue India feature. Traditional teams prioritise completeness, ensuring every ritual, every family group shot, and every guest is documented without gaps. Most premium wedding cinematography packages now offer a hybrid approach: candid coverage during ceremonies and a dedicated editorial session for high-end bridal portrait sessions. Destination wedding photo and video coverage in Goa also increasingly incorporates drone aerials, underwater photography at beachside venues, and 360-degree virtual reality footage for couples wanting cutting-edge deliverables. When reviewing portfolios, look specifically for Goa work — does the photographer understand the harsh midday light on white sand, or how to expose correctly against a deep-red sunset over the Arabian Sea? Ask for a full-length cinematic wedding film sample rather than just highlight reels. The reel shows skill; the full film reveals storytelling stamina, pacing, and the team's ability to keep emotional momentum across two or three event days. Golden hour photography sessions are particularly revealing — they show whether the team is proactive about positioning or reactive and rushed.
What Should Your Pre-Wedding Shoot and Portraits in Goa Include?
A well-planned pre-wedding shoot in Goa is far more than a warm-up — it is a strategic content-creation exercise and a relationship-building session between the couple and the photography team before the actual wedding day. The best pre-wedding shoot locations in Goa span multiple environments: early morning golden hour photography sessions at Palolem or Butterfly Beach before tourist crowds arrive; mid-morning structured portraits inside Portuguese-era mansions in Chandor or Quepem where diffused indoor light creates a painterly effect; and late-afternoon sunset sessions at Chapora Fort or the backwaters of Caculo Island. A high-end bridal portrait session typically involves three to four outfit changes, a hairstylist and makeup artist on-site, and a detailed shot-list crafted collaboratively between the creative director and the couple in advance. Props — vintage Lambretta scooters, wicker beach chairs, terracotta pots of marigolds — are sourced locally to anchor the images in Goa's distinctive cultural personality. For couples considering Luxury Destination Wedding Photography & Video Experiences spanning multiple days, the pre-wedding shoot footage is often woven into the opening of the cinematic wedding film production, creating a narrative that begins with the couple's arrival story and builds organically into the ceremony. Budget between ₹60,000 and ₹2 lakh for a full-day pre-wedding shoot in Goa, including location access fees, props, and post-production. Some premium wedding cinematography packages bundle this session, so always clarify before negotiating. Including golden hour photography sessions both in the pre-wedding shoot and on the wedding day itself significantly elevates the final visual portfolio.

How to Choose the Right Option
✅ Pre-booking Checklist
- Define your must-have deliverables: photos only, highlight reel, full cinematic film, drone footage, or all of the above
- Set a realistic photography and video budget — minimum 10–12% of total wedding planning budget in Goa
- Request and review a full-length cinematic wedding film (not just a reel) from your shortlisted teams
- Confirm team composition in writing — which specific individuals will attend your wedding, not just the studio brand
- Clarify drone permissions, especially if your venue is near the coast or within a DGCA restricted zone
- Lock the pre-wedding shoot date and locations at least 4–6 weeks before the main event
- Confirm delivery timelines, copyright ownership, raw footage handover, and revision rounds in the contract
- Schedule a golden hour photography session window into your official event timeline with your wedding planner
🎯 Selection Criteria
- Portfolio consistency across multiple Goa events — not just their best single wedding
- Clear communication style and responsiveness during the inquiry process
- Proven experience with multi-day, multi-venue destination wedding photo and video coverage
- Technical capability: cinema-grade cameras, licensed drones, backup equipment, and lighting rigs
- Transparent pricing with an itemised quote rather than a vague package description
- Cultural familiarity with the specific rituals and community traditions of your wedding
💰 Cost / Quality Factors
- Team size and seniority directly impact the depth and consistency of coverage across a multi-day event
- Peak-season dates (November–February) command a 20–40% premium over off-season rates
- Post-production quality — colour grading, audio mixing, and editing pace — determines the final film's emotional impact
- Travel, accommodation, and per-diem costs for out-of-state teams can add ₹75,000–₹2 lakh to the total
- Fine-art album printing, premium packaging, and hard-drive deliveries add ₹30,000–₹1 lakh to base package costs
- Experience with Goa's specific lighting conditions — harsh beach noon, low-light church interiors, candlelit reception halls — reduces risk of technically flawed images
⚠️ Common Mistakes to Avoid
- Booking based on price alone without reviewing full-length films or multi-event portfolios
- Assuming the photographer who shot portfolio samples will personally attend your wedding — always confirm in writing
- Leaving drone permissions to the last minute — DGCA clearances can take weeks at restricted Goa venues
- Not briefing the team on family group-shot requirements, leading to chaotic and time-consuming portraits during the reception
- Skipping the pre-wedding recce — a site visit by the photography team before the event significantly improves shot planning and light-mapping
- Overlooking contract clauses on delivery timelines and copyright, which can result in delays or disputes over image usage rights
